Lines Matching refs:irq_desc

38 static void __synchronize_hardirq(struct irq_desc *desc, bool sync_chip)  in __synchronize_hardirq()
100 struct irq_desc *desc = irq_to_desc(irq); in synchronize_hardirq()
128 struct irq_desc *desc = irq_to_desc(irq); in synchronize_irq()
146 static bool __irq_can_set_affinity(struct irq_desc *desc) in __irq_can_set_affinity()
173 struct irq_desc *desc = irq_to_desc(irq); in irq_can_set_affinity_usr()
188 void irq_set_thread_affinity(struct irq_desc *desc) in irq_set_thread_affinity()
215 struct irq_desc *desc = irq_data_to_desc(data); in irq_do_set_affinity()
294 struct irq_desc *desc = irq_data_to_desc(data); in irq_set_affinity_pending()
326 struct irq_desc *desc = irq_data_to_desc(data); in irq_set_affinity_deactivated()
351 struct irq_desc *desc = irq_data_to_desc(data); in irq_set_affinity_locked()
398 struct irq_desc *desc; in irq_update_affinity_desc()
453 struct irq_desc *desc = irq_to_desc(irq); in __irq_set_affinity()
500 struct irq_desc *desc = irq_get_desc_lock(irq, &flags, IRQ_GET_DESC_CHECK_GLOBAL); in __irq_apply_affinity_hint()
516 struct irq_desc *desc = irq_to_desc(notify->irq); in irq_affinity_notify()
551 struct irq_desc *desc = irq_to_desc(irq); in irq_set_affinity_notifier()
589 int irq_setup_affinity(struct irq_desc *desc) in irq_setup_affinity()
631 int irq_setup_affinity(struct irq_desc *desc) in irq_setup_affinity()
653 struct irq_desc *desc = irq_get_desc_lock(irq, &flags, 0); in irq_set_vcpu_affinity()
681 void __disable_irq(struct irq_desc *desc) in __disable_irq()
690 struct irq_desc *desc = irq_get_desc_buslock(irq, &flags, IRQ_GET_DESC_CHECK_GLOBAL); in __disable_irq_nosync()
776 void __enable_irq(struct irq_desc *desc) in __enable_irq()
818 struct irq_desc *desc = irq_get_desc_buslock(irq, &flags, IRQ_GET_DESC_CHECK_GLOBAL); in enable_irq()
848 struct irq_desc *desc = irq_to_desc(irq); in set_irq_wake_real()
882 struct irq_desc *desc = irq_get_desc_buslock(irq, &flags, IRQ_GET_DESC_CHECK_GLOBAL); in irq_set_irq_wake()
931 struct irq_desc *desc = irq_get_desc_lock(irq, &flags, 0); in can_request_irq()
946 int __irq_set_trigger(struct irq_desc *desc, unsigned long flags) in __irq_set_trigger()
1005 struct irq_desc *desc = irq_get_desc_lock(irq, &flags, 0); in irq_set_parent()
1074 static void irq_finalize_oneshot(struct irq_desc *desc, in irq_finalize_oneshot()
1129 irq_thread_check_affinity(struct irq_desc *desc, struct irqaction *action) in irq_thread_check_affinity()
1167 irq_thread_check_affinity(struct irq_desc *desc, struct irqaction *action) { } in irq_thread_check_affinity()
1177 irq_forced_thread_fn(struct irq_desc *desc, struct irqaction *action) in irq_forced_thread_fn()
1200 static irqreturn_t irq_thread_fn(struct irq_desc *desc, in irq_thread_fn()
1213 static void wake_threads_waitq(struct irq_desc *desc) in wake_threads_waitq()
1222 struct irq_desc *desc; in irq_thread_dtor()
1246 static void irq_wake_secondary(struct irq_desc *desc, struct irqaction *action) in irq_wake_secondary()
1261 static void irq_thread_set_ready(struct irq_desc *desc, in irq_thread_set_ready()
1272 static void wake_up_and_wait_for_irq_thread_ready(struct irq_desc *desc, in wake_up_and_wait_for_irq_thread_ready()
1290 struct irq_desc *desc = irq_to_desc(action->irq); in irq_thread()
1291 irqreturn_t (*handler_fn)(struct irq_desc *desc, in irq_thread()
1339 struct irq_desc *desc = irq_to_desc(irq); in irq_wake_thread()
1397 static int irq_request_resources(struct irq_desc *desc) in irq_request_resources()
1405 static void irq_release_resources(struct irq_desc *desc) in irq_release_resources()
1414 static bool irq_supports_nmi(struct irq_desc *desc) in irq_supports_nmi()
1430 static int irq_nmi_setup(struct irq_desc *desc) in irq_nmi_setup()
1438 static void irq_nmi_teardown(struct irq_desc *desc) in irq_nmi_teardown()
1497 __setup_irq(unsigned int irq, struct irq_desc *desc, struct irqaction *new) in __setup_irq()
1866 static struct irqaction *__free_irq(struct irq_desc *desc, void *dev_id) in __free_irq()
2020 struct irq_desc *desc = irq_to_desc(irq); in free_irq()
2044 static const void *__cleanup_nmi(unsigned int irq, struct irq_desc *desc) in __cleanup_nmi()
2072 struct irq_desc *desc = irq_to_desc(irq); in free_nmi()
2143 struct irq_desc *desc; in request_threaded_irq()
2249 struct irq_desc *desc; in request_any_context_irq()
2300 struct irq_desc *desc; in request_nmi()
2370 struct irq_desc *desc = irq_get_desc_lock(irq, &flags, IRQ_GET_DESC_CHECK_PERCPU); in enable_percpu_irq()
2415 struct irq_desc *desc; in irq_percpu_is_enabled()
2434 struct irq_desc *desc = irq_get_desc_lock(irq, &flags, IRQ_GET_DESC_CHECK_PERCPU); in disable_percpu_irq()
2454 struct irq_desc *desc = irq_to_desc(irq); in __free_percpu_irq()
2504 struct irq_desc *desc = irq_to_desc(irq); in remove_percpu_irq()
2524 struct irq_desc *desc = irq_to_desc(irq); in free_percpu_irq()
2537 struct irq_desc *desc = irq_to_desc(irq); in free_percpu_nmi()
2557 struct irq_desc *desc = irq_to_desc(irq); in setup_percpu_irq()
2597 struct irq_desc *desc; in __request_percpu_irq()
2662 struct irq_desc *desc; in request_percpu_nmi()
2729 struct irq_desc *desc; in prepare_percpu_nmi()
2772 struct irq_desc *desc; in teardown_percpu_nmi()
2829 struct irq_desc *desc; in irq_get_irqchip_state()
2862 struct irq_desc *desc; in irq_set_irqchip_state()
2924 struct irq_desc *desc; in irq_check_status_bit()